FAQ's of Deionized Water:
Q: How is deionized water produced to ensure its high purity?
A: Deionized water is manufactured by passing tap or distilled water through ion exchange resins that remove dissolved ions such as calcium, chloride, and iron. This process ensures the water achieves a purity level of 99.9% and maintains very low conductivity and total dissolved solids.
Q: What are the main applications of deionized water?
A: Deionized water is widely used in laboratories, pharmaceutical manufacturing, industrial processes, cooling systems, and cosmetics where contaminant-free water is essential to maintain equipment integrity and product quality.
Q: When should deionized water be used instead of regular distilled or tap water?
A: Deionized water should be chosen for any procedure or product where even trace impurities could interfere with processes or outcomes, such as in analytical chemistry, high-purity manufacturing, or sensitive equipment cooling.

Q: What benefits does deionized water offer over other types of purified water?
A: Deionized water provides extremely low levels of total dissolved solids and ions, ensuring minimal interference with chemical reactions, preventing scale formation in equipment, and enhancing the reliability of scientific or technical applications.
Q: Can deionized water be used for cosmetic formulation?
A: Yes, due to its impurity-free nature, deionized water is ideal for cosmetics manufacturing, ensuring product stability and safety by preventing unwanted chemical reactions with active ingredients.
